By Andrew Loewe
ADA — The Ohio Northern women's lacrosse team fell 14-8 Wednesday night against Baldwin Wallace in the regular season finale at Dial-Roberson Stadium.
With the loss, the Polar Bears finish the regular season 7-9 overall and 3-5 in the Ohio Athletic Conference. Northern will be the sixth seed in the OAC Tournament and will play in the quarterfinals on Saturday at third-seeded Mount Union.
The Yellow Jackets finish the regular season 7-9, 4-4 and earn the fifth seed in the OAC Tournament.
The balanced ONU scoring attack was led by junior Amanda Wells (Mason) and sophomores Avary Snyder (Uniontown/Lake) and Elizabeth Graham (Riverside/Carroll) with two goals each.
Sophomore Chloe Millican (Fishers, Ind./Hamilton Southeastern) (3-3) had nine saves on 23 shots.
Graham evened the score 5-5 with 8:54 to go in the first half, where the score remained at halftime.
Graham also scored the first goal of the second half to break the tie 6-5 in favor of the Polar Bears.
The Yellow Jackets responded with three unanswered goals to regain the lead 8-6 with 2:09 remaining in the third quarter.
ONU shrank the lead to 8-7 with 1:15 left in the third quarter on a goal by freshman Keaghan Burden (Brunswick), but BW scored six of the next seven goals to pull away for the victory.
The Yellow Jackets out-shot the Polar Bears 34-22 and won the ground ball battle 27-20.
